tp官方下载安卓最新版本2024_tpwallet最新版本 | TP官方app下载/苹果正版安装-数字钱包app官方下载
引言:当手机反复提示“TP钱包屡次停止运行”时,表面是应用层崩溃,深层则可能牵涉移动端兼容性、网络/TLS握手、RPC节点压力、智能合约执行、跨链桥与交易验证机制等多维因素。下面分层分析并给出面向用户与开发者的建议。
一、用户端故障排查(快速检查)
1) 更新与重装:确认TP钱包为最新版本,若问题依旧,尝试清缓存或重装以排除包与数据损坏。
2) 权限与电池策略:检查后台运行与网络权限,关闭系统的“省电/后台限制”。
3) WebView/系统组件:Android上依赖系统WebView或Chromium内核,需确保其为最新。
4) 切换网络与RPC:尝试切换Wi‑Fi/蜂窝或更换默认RPC节点,排除网络超时或节点不稳定造成的主线程阻塞。
5) 日志收集:在开发者选项开启ADB/logcat以抓取崩溃堆栈,用于上报给开发者。
二、开发者视角的根因分析
1) 主线程阻塞:耗时网络请求、签名或合约模拟在UI线程执行会导致ANR/崩溃。应把重操作移到工作线程/协程。
2) 内存与JNI泄露:大量未释放的缓存、图片或原生库内存泄露会触发OOM。
3) 并发与线程安全:多请求并发写同一数据库或共享结构可能产生竞态和非法状态。
4) WebView/第三方SDK冲突:不同版本库之间的兼容问题常导致崩溃。
三、网络与TLS相关问题
1) TLS版本与握手超时:TLS 1.3/1.2的配置不当、证书链问题或证书钉扎失效会造成连接失败并阻塞操作。启用合理的超时与重试策略,兼容QUIC/HTTP3可提升稳定性。
2) 证书校验与0‑RTT:证书校验严格有助安全,但在移动网络切换时可能增加失败概率;0‑RTT可降低延迟但需权衡重放攻击风险。
3) 连接复用与池化:正确实现HTTP连接池和长连接截断策略,避免大量短连接引发的资源耗尽。
四、合约性能与即时交易挑战
1) 合约复杂度:复杂计算或大量事件读取会导致前端等待时间长,影响用户体验。合约应优化逻辑、使用预计算与索引服务。
2) 瞬时吞吐与gas波动:高频交易或做市会遇到gas飙升,导致交易失败或重试风暴。前端应提供更友好的失败提示与自动回滚机制。
3) 即时成交方案:链下撮合/订单簿、状态通道或L2 sequencer能实现即时交易,但需权衡中心化风险与最终性。
五、多链资产兑换与交易验证
1) 桥与跨链协议:现有桥多采用锁定+发行或中继/验证人机制,存在延迟与安全边界。原子兑换、HTLC及跨链验证器(Light client / relayer / zk 抽样)可提升安全性。
2) 交易证明与轻客户端:基于SPV、Merkle证明或zk证明的轻客户端能在移动端实现更可靠的交易验证,减少对第三方RPC的信任。
3) 签名聚合与批量验证:BLS等聚合签名能降低验证开销,提升多签与跨链操作效率。

六、行业趋势与技术演进
1) L2与zk‑rollups普及,将把即时交易、低费率和最终性带到移动端钱包。
2) QUIC/HTTP3与TLS1.3+会成为移动钱包的主流传输层,改善连接恢复与延迟。
3) 增强隐私与可扩展验证(zk‑SNARK/STARK)将改变跨链验证与资产兑换的信任模型。
4) 边缘计算与硬件安全模块(TEE、Secure Enclave)将强化私钥管理与签名性能。

七、建议(对用户与开发者)
用户:更新应用、清缓存、切换RPC或网络、收集并上报日志;遇资产异常优先断网与咨询官方客服。
开发者:把阻塞操作移出主线程、实现稳健的超时/重试/熔断器、提供多节点和RPC回退、采用安全且高效的TLS配置、利用轻客户端或zk验证减少对中心化信任的依赖、对合约做gas与逻辑优化并提供链下加速设施(indexer、缓存层)。
结语:TP钱包屡次停止运行往往是多因素叠加的结果,从移动端资源管理、网络/TLS配置到合约与跨链架构都可能触发崩溃。通过系统的排查、提升传输与验证层设计,以及拥抱L2/zk等新技术,既能改善用户体验,也能增强安全性与可扩展性。